Decode Your Partner's Love Language

Understanding your partner's love language can dramatically boost your relationship. It involves recognizing how they best perceive love. Some common love languages encompass copyright of affirmation, acts of service, receiving gifts, quality time, and physical touch. By learning their primary language, you can express your affection in a way that truly resonates with them.

  • copyright of affirmation can be as simple as saying "I love you" or "You look amazing today."
  • Acts of service demonstrate your care through helpful actions, like doing the dishes or running errands.
  • Thoughtful items don't have to be extravagant; they should be significant and show you were thinking of them.
  • Quality time involves spending undivided time with your partner, engaging in activities together.
  • Physical touch can be as tender as holding hands or giving a hug; it conveys warmth and closeness.

Navigating Conflict with Grace and Understanding

Conflicts are an inevitable part of interpersonal interaction. However, tackling these issues with grace and understanding can improve the outcome. Firstly, it is crucial to nurture a environment of empathy. Attentive listening, clarifying points of view, and sharing emotions honestly can aid a productive dialogue.

Furthermore, seeking common ground and underscoring shared goals can bolster the bond. Remember that compromise sometimes involves flexibility and a sincere desire to comprehend the other's stance.

Secrets for a Happy and Healthy Couple

A truly strong relationship thrives on clear and honest communication. Don't just discuss, hear each other's copyright. Make room for frequent check-ins to express your concerns and challenges. Remember, even a simple "I care about you" can make a difference.

  • Practice active listening skills by paying full attention when your partner is speaking.
  • Employ "I" statements to express your feelings without blaming or attacking.
  • Remain patient and understanding, remembering that every person expresses themselves differently.
